#TicketingNews: Metro Canterbury has passed 500,000 tag-ons with contactless payments.

54,000 of those tag-ons were from last week alone.

#StationNews: Waitematฤ Local Board chair Alex Bonham has clarified how late trains will run once the CRL is open.

It is expected that Sunday to Thursday, trains will run until 11 pm/midnight, and between 1 - 2 am on Fridays and Saturdays.

#RailNews: Metlink has shared photos of their storm-damaged carriages that operate on the Wairarapa Line.

The damaged carriages have been removed from service for repairs, meaning full timetables cannot be run at present.

#BusNews: @yt_joshtransit on X has spotted the Alexander Dennis Enviro100 EV Demonstrator in service on Waiheke Island.

It is currently on a trial with Waiheke Bus Company (Fullers360) and is numbered WB158.
